Smooth Cellphone Updates: Download and Install Firmware

Keeping your device running smoothly is crucial for a positive user experience. One Factory reset firmware key aspect of maintenance is staying up-to-date with the latest firmware. Firmware updates often bring bug fixes, performance improvements, and new functionality. Thankfully, updating your cellphone is generally a easy process. You can usually download the newest firmware directly from your device manufacturer's website or through the built-in settings menu on your phone. Once downloaded, the update program will guide you through the installation steps. It's important to confirm you have a stable internet connection and sufficient battery power before initiating the update process.

  • Prior to starting the update, back up your important data just in case anything unexpected occurs.
  • During the update, avoid using your device or interrupting the process.
  • Following the update, restart your phone to ensure all changes are implemented correctly.
